Dr. Maria Elena Ruiz, MD is an infectious disease internist in Washington, DC and has over 25 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from George Washington University School of Medicine & Health Sciences in 1997. She is affiliated with medical facilities George Washington University Hospital and MedStar Washington Hospital Center. She is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
